A full-time Speech-Language Pathologist (SLP) position is available at a K-12 school located in Newark, DE. This contract role spans the normal school year (NSY) and requires onsite presence. The ideal candidate will provide therapeutic services to students across pediatric age groups, supporting communication development and related speech-language needs.

Responsibilities: Conduct speech-language evaluations and develop individualized treatment plans for students. Deliver direct therapy services to K-12 students in a school setting. Collaborate with educators, families, and other professionals to support student progress. Maintain thorough documentation and progress reports in compliance with educational and clinical standards. Participate in team meetings and professional development as required. Qualifications: Certificate of Clinical Competence in Speech-Language Pathology (SLP - CCC). Licensed or eligible for licensure to practice as a Speech-Language Pathologist in Delaware. Certified by DE ASHA (American Speech-Language-Hearing Association). Experience in pediatric speech-language services and school-based therapy. Able to deliver teletherapy as needed, with familiarity in both onsite and remote therapy modalities. Completed Clinical Fellowship Year (CFY). Strong communication and organizational skills. This role offers the opportunity to work directly with school-aged children within a dynamic educational environment.
